Bruce Sherwood On Fri, Oct 29, 2010 at 8:38 AM, Beracah Yankama <be...@mi...> wrote: > hah! now i'm not the only one who noticed this! i was graphing a lot > of data too with lots of curves (a graph cluster growing to thousands of > nodes and edges, which are dynamically positioned), but after like 200 > edges and being repositioned, an out of memory error gets thrown. I had > tracked it down to vpython. > > I had written (in case it is helpful to you): > """ > I made a test script, that only > creates objects in the window, then deletes them over and over, and I > found the long-term memory use/growth to be related linearly to the .pos > attribute. For instance, a curve with 20 points leads to unreleased > memory that grows 10x as fast as curves with only 2 points.
